The Code Compliance division in the Economic Development & Planning Department is seeking a Premise Officer that would be excited to join their professional team. This is a great opportunity for anyone seeking to use their knowledge in construction and building trades to gain additional experience. This position will ensure that the exterior premises of homes within the City of Lansing meet the standards of City Ordinances and Code Compliance.u00a0The City of Lansing offers a competitive wage and benefit package including medical, vision, dental, paid vacation, and sick leave.u00a0S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S & TRAINING:u00a0u00a0u00a0- Must obtain ICC Property Maintenance & Housing Inspector Certificationu00a0ANDu00a0ICC Zoning Inspector Certification within six (6) months of employment.u00a0- Must possess and maintain a valid Michigan driver's license.IDEAL CANDIDATES WILL POSSESS THE FOLLOWING:u00a0u00a0u00a0- High School Diploma or GED (Course work in building trades, planning or residential construction,u00a0preferred);u00a0AND- Two (2) years of experience in building trades, planning or residential construction.- An equivalent combination of education and experience may be considered.- Basic computer skills required, must also be able to use a laptop computer in a mobile environment.ESSENTIAL POSITION FUNCTIONS INLCUDE BUT ARE NOT LIMITED TO:u00a0u00a0u00a0- Investigates, inspects and takes appropriate action to abate sub-standard housing relating to exterior premises such as trash, debris, tall grass/weeds, disabled abandoned motor vehicles (DAMV), front yard parking (FYP), vision obstruction, open and accessible, and premises identification. Must be able to accurately observe and interpret information in accordance with the City of Lansing (COL) Ordinances.- Works with Code compliance Enforcement officers, Premise Officers, administrative staff, Department Leadership, and the Code Enforcement Manager to help monitor, issue correction notices, and authorize abatement of violations when necessary.- Inspects properties within the City for violations of the City's codified ordinance. Complete re-inspections of properties that have received a violation and evaluate whether it should be complied with or abated.- Prepares, maintains, and updates files and records regarding violations.
